cnc machining center CNC machining offers unparalleled capabilities for producing the intricate and robust parts that define modern fluid handling equipment. From multistage pump housings and impellers with complex vanes to valve bodies, stems, and custom fittings, CNC technology handles a vast range of materials essential to the industry. Whether it's corrosionresistant stainless steels, durable duplex alloys, engineered plastics like PEEK, or robust brass, CNC machines deliver consistent, hightolerance parts. This material versatility ensures compatibility with everything from aggressive chemicals and hightemperature steam to potable water and pharmaceutical fluids.
The benefits directly translate to enhanced product performance and operational growth. Fiveaxis CNC machining allows for the creation of optimized internal geometries that improve hydraulic efficiency and reduce cavitation in pumps. The exceptional surface finishes achievable minimize friction and wear in valve seals and moving parts, extending service life and reducing downtime. Furthermore, CNC prototyping accelerates innovation, enabling faster development of nextgeneration, energyefficient designs.
